终于有人把超融合和边缘计算说清楚了

戳蓝字“CSDN云计算”关注我们哦!

作者 | 采葑

责编 | 阿秃

近年来超融合在国内迎来快速增长,根据IDC最新发布的报告,2019上半年中国超融合市场增长率达56.7%,大幅超越去年同期。Gartner发布的最新报告,到2023年我国超融合市场依旧保持23%的快速增长。超融合覆盖范围正在进一步扩大,不仅服务的客户在向大规模企业扩张,应用场景也从服务器虚拟化、VDI扩展到数据库、私有云等关键业务。

随着5G时代边缘计算数据中心的兴起,超融合市场正在迎来更大的发展空间。Gartner预测,2023年35%以上的超融合产品将应用在边缘计算领域。一起来了解一下超融合和边缘计算吧!

01

 超融合的起源与内涵

随着云技术和虚拟化技术的发展,网络服务的构建有了新的思路和方案。2013 年的 vmware 大会上提出 VSAN 技术,其主要概念是在虚拟化集群中安装闪存和硬盘来构造存储层。VSAN 技术配置具有足够磁盘插槽和存储控制器的 VSAN主机,形成可扩展的分布式存储架构,生成易于管理的共享存储源。在 VSAN 技术的基础上诞生了超融合架构的概念。

超融合架构是新一代横向扩展的软件定义架构,它由整合了 CPU、内存、存储、网络和虚拟化软件平台的通用硬件单元组成,没有固定的中心节点。它的核心概念包括线性的横向扩展、计算能力和存储能力相融合、服务器端采用高速闪存作为存储介质。超融合架构打破了传统的服务器、网络和存储的孤立界线,实现一个统一的HCI形态。

02

 超融合是什么?

 

超融合的“超”指“虚拟化”,“超融合”的英文为 Hyper-Converged。可以看到,超融合架构虽然有一个“超”字,但其并不是什么神秘的概念,也并非“超级”的意思,而是与英文Hypervisor 中的 Hyper 相对应,是虚拟化的意思,对应着虚拟化这一计算架构。

超融合架构最核心的改变是存储,而这一概念的最初推动者也都是来自于互联网背景的存储初创厂商。底层采用标准化的 x86  硬件平台,上层采用软件定义的方式,将计算、存储、网络等资源集成在一起,既简化了部署,又提高了运维效率。即超融合是通过软件定义技术构建大规模数据中心的启发,结合虚拟化技术和企业 IT 的场景,为企业实现可扩展的 IT 基础架构。

 

“超融合架构”是指在同一套单元设备(x86服务器)中不仅仅具备计算、网络、存储和服务器虚拟化等资源和技术,而且还包括缓存加速、重复数据删除、在线数据压缩、备份软件、快照技术等元素,而多节点可以通过网络聚合起来,实现模块化的无缝横向扩展(scale-out),形成统一的资源池。

可以理解超融合是一种基于硬件之上,操作系统之下的中间件,是软件定义数据中心(SDDC)的架构,也是一种新兴的数据中心基础设施解决方案。超融合的技术核心是利用分布式文件系统(NDFS)来替代传统的SAN和NAS存储和昂贵的装用SAN交换机构建的存储网络,将虚拟化计算和存储高度整合到一个平台。目前业界普遍的认为,软件定义的分布式存储层和虚拟化计算是超融合架构的最小集,一般都具有以下通用核心组件:

 

(1)基于X86服务器架构的分布式存储。在服务器虚拟化的基础上,通过部署存储虚拟设备的方式,对本地存储资源进行虚拟化,再经集群整合成资源池,为虚拟机提供存储服务。

 

(2)高速网络。超融合使用万兆以太网,为分布式计算和存储集群提供可扩展和高可用性的网络通道。

 

(3)统一管理平台。虚拟化计算和存储在同一个平台进行管理,管理员在同一套平台下进行性能、容量的监控,问题排查等运维工作。

 

通过超融合架构融合了计算、存储和网络等资源,创建一个整体化的资源池,从而实现存储的共享,并且通过存储的冗余功能,实现高可用性。

看懂超融合了吗?

 

03

 “汉堡”与超融合

上面说了那么多,可能还是不懂,举生活中常见的“汉堡”来解释一下超融合吧!

我们知道,以往数据中心的计算、存储和网络各自都是独立的,而超融合系统打破了这一局面。在超融合中,计算与存储两者以合二为一,再通过软件定义的形式将它们打通,构成了我们常见的超融合一体机。

 

 

上面这段话如果用汉堡来比喻,是这样▼

在汉堡中,上下两层面包就是计算与存储,中间的夹心就是软件定义和各种服务。这三者作为一个整体紧密协作,为企业和运维人员带来了很多好处——

快速部署

正常一顿饭,淘米煮饭、洗菜、烧菜,道道工序必不可少,非得懂个十八般武艺不可。而制作汉堡,两片面包加上蔬菜、奶酪和一块午餐肉,10分钟搞定,都不用开火。正如超融合系统,从开机到 VM 调配只需十几分钟,业务快速上线不是梦。

易于扩展

没有什么是一个汉堡吃不饱的,如果有,那就来个巨无霸!

超融合可以从小规模起步,随着业务量增长,按需扩展即可,性能随规模线性提升!

简便运维

汉堡制作方便,后续清理也方便,吃完了不用洗碗,省时又省力。正如超融合在一个系统界面下实现所有硬件设备、资源、功能的统一管理,出了故障不用逐一排查,系统一扫简单明了,大大节约了运维人员的工作量。

说到这儿,你可能好奇:“为什么把软件定义和各种服务当成夹心,计算和存储不可以?”

这样排列当然是有理由的,因为夹心作为汉堡的灵魂,直接决定了汉堡的好吃与否。就像超融合的计算和存储,都是基于标准的X86架构下生产的通用硬件,而软件定义和各种服务才是各家厂商比拼实力的地方。

 

04

 超融合优缺点

 

超融合优点

传统 IT 架构化分为很多系统和团队,比如存储、服务器、网络。其中存储团队负责采购、扩充、支持存储设备,维护存储系统,和存储厂商打交道。服务器和网络团队也是一样的做法。而融合系统就是把其中的两级或者更多系统通过预制合成为 1 个。VCE和 HP 提供这种融合系统,用软件把存储、计算、网络整合起来。VCE = VMware + Cisco + EMC,支持Hyper-V和KVM等管理程序。融合系统只能是通过不同组件来组合,而超融合系统更进一步做成了模块化设计,各种组件还可以扩展。

 

超融合缺点

没办法自己升级系统模组内部的组件,比如加 CPU、硬盘,只能继续增加一个新的模组。比如存储比较缺,但是 CPU 是够的,但还得买个模组加进来补充存储,CPU 就多余了。当然自己搭建内部模组就不会有这个问题。旧有系统和新系统的整合不便。比如服务器部门买了超融合系统,就相当于把自己的预算花在了存储上,而存储部门也不想因为买了超融合系统而帮计算部门管理计算资源。

 

05

 边缘计算呼唤超融合

边缘计算(edge computing)是指一种在网络边缘进行计算的新型计算模式,其对数据的处理主要包括两部分:其一是下行的云服务,其二是上行的万物互联服务。其中,边缘计算当中的“边缘”是一个相对的概念,主要是指从数据源到云计算中心路径之间的任意计算、存储以及网络相关资源。

万物互联时代产生海量数据导致计算处理能力前移,我们发现最迫切的需求是处理能力和存储资源,而且需求量很大,当然还需要数据分析工具,将软件和数据推送到边缘的工具,以及跨边缘与集中式云联合起来的方法,甚至需要在边缘本身处的机器学习。这一切的一切都清晰地指出,边缘需要一些更加强大的基础架构能力。

 

我们认为,超融合适合边缘计算有以下三个理由:

 

• 满足新边缘节点的定位

 

– 边缘计算让计算靠近数据,数据处理应用,分析应用软件都将部署到边缘,超融合可以为边缘节点提供更强大的性能和存储空间。

– HCI完全虚拟化的广泛兼容应用软件,拥有合理存储能力、计算能力和弹性扩展能力,可以满足更多系统搭载的需求。

 

• 满足边缘计算的受限环境

 

– 边缘的工作环境条件低于IDC,空间,能耗,维护便利性都不乐观。

– 精简型HCI更小尺寸,占用空间小,功耗更低,散热要求更低,模块化快速部署能力,远程管理能力。

• 大幅提升中的性价比

 

– 边缘计算规模大,大批量的采购场景中,性价比必须考虑。

– HCI的硬件正变得更强劲,价格同时也在下降。

 

同时,超融合架构相比传统系统,是一个“预处理”好的模块化基础架构,省掉很多逐个项目设计部署的工作,而以最适合应用程序的标准化形式创建一致的范例和环境来运行工作负载。如今许多边缘工作负载都在Linux或VM上运行,基本可以无缝迁移到超融合基础架构。

 

而关于超融合产品在边缘计算里出现的形态,目前看和普通的超融合产品还是有所区别的。目前超融合集中部署的情况还是比较多,很多都部署在大型企业用户IDC或者云服务商IDC里。而针对边缘的使用场景,更合理的形态是精简加固型硬件平台,具有小尺寸,低能耗,高可维护性和安全性的特点,同时还具有其他附加特性,如GPS/加密/自毁等标准产品上不会出现的功能。同时它必须具有完整系统的兼容性,具有相对完整的OS平台,能够搭载大多数的基础数据分析平台。 

06

 展望

Gartner预测到2022年,所有企业将有75%全面展开边缘计算战略。在未来两年边缘计算大行其道的时刻,我们相信超融合基础架构能够帮助大家应对在这一全新领域要解决的许多新挑战,一些刚性需求诸如小尺寸,低能耗,极简部署,易于管理和维护性等能够得到满足,有力支持边缘计算发展。

参考文献:

 

[1] 郭涛.超融合就是这么简单 [J].中国计算机报.

[2] 钱朝阳.浅谈超融合基础架构 [J].网络与信息工程.

[3] 于耳.一种基于vSAN的分布式存储系统构建和应用 [J].中国教育信息化

[4] 戴尔.老妈问我什么是超融合 [M].

福利扫描添加小编微信,备注“姓名+公司职位”,加入【云计算学习交流群】,和志同道合的朋友们共同打卡学习!
推荐阅读:
  • 详解异构计算FPGA基础知识

  • 苹果新专利:没信号也可求救,同时开启超长待机;谷歌被爆2500亿美元收购Salesforce;号段1740的中国卫星电话来了……

  • 达摩院 2020 预测:模块化降低芯片设计门槛 | 问底中国 IT 技术演进

  • 千万不要和程序员一起合租!

  • 在调查过基于模型的强化学习方法后,我们得到这些结论

  • Twitter 出现重大 Bug导致政客手机号码泄露?竟是由于这个原因导致的……

真香,朕在看了!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/519569.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

表格存储TableStore全新升级,打造统一的在线数据存储平台!

表格存储TableStore是阿里云自研的面向海量结构化和半结构化数据存储的Serverless NoSQL多模型数据库,被广泛用于社交、物联网、人工智能、元数据和大数据等业务场景。表格存储TableStore采用与Google Bigtable类似的宽表模型,天然的分布式架构&#xff…

java短信验证码功能发送的验证码如何校验_企业如何选择短信平台才能保障安全和稳定性?...

现如今互联网不断发展,人们对网络的依赖性越来越大, 伴随而来的网络运营安全问题越来越严重,安全是我们企业都担忧的一个大问题,短信平台的安全性再次被企业所重视起来。短信验证码日常生活中经常遇到,比如银行卡的绑定…

“我哥毕业1年,做Python挣了50W!”网友:吹得太少...

现状揭秘:Python岗位大厂50K起?程序员:心态崩了!屠杀各种榜单,拿下语言排行榜的Python,薪酬真的如同网传开挂了吗?笔者在脉脉上发现了这样的一个信息:但Python真的这么火&#xff1f…

Nvidia GPU如何在Kubernetes 里工作

Nvidia GPU如何在Kubernetes 里工作 本文介绍Nvidia GPU设备如何在Kubernetes中管理调度。 整个工作流程分为以下两个方面: 如何在容器中使用GPUKubernetes 如何调度GPU如何在容器中使用GPU 想要在容器中的应用可以操作GPU, 需要实两个目标 容器中可…

mysql的每隔1分钟定时_简单易用,spring boot集成quartz,实现分布式定时任务

什么是quartz?Quartz是一个完全由 Java 编写的开源任务调度框架。我们经常会遇到一些问题:想每个月27号,提醒信用卡还款;想每隔1小时,提醒一下,累了,站起来活动一下;想每个月定时发送…

阿里云安全肖力:从RSA2019看安全技术发展的十个机遇

又一年RSA大会归来。每一年参会,总会有一些不同的感悟,或是发现全球安全行业的新趋势,或是找到志同道合的新伙伴,或是看到很多人也相信我们相信的安全技术新方向。今天在回国的航班上提笔写下我的感悟和判断,希望对安全…

华为组织架调整,CloudAI升至第四大BG,打通全球第一款集成5G模组的4K直播编码器网络通信服务;谷歌宣布与IBM合作……...

关注并标星星CSDN云计算 速递、最新、绝对有料。这里有企业新动、这里有业界要闻,打起十二分精神,紧跟fashion你可以的!每周两次,打卡即read更快、更全了解泛云圈精彩newsgo go goIntel 10nm Tiger Lake晶圆首曝:核心面…

flowable DMN部署单独使用_06

文章目录配置规则部署使用项目地址:https://gitee.com/lwj/flowable.git 分支flowable-base视频地址:https://www.bilibili.com/video/av79774697/DMN部署: dmn制定了规则之后,还需要部署好才能用DMN部署,独立使用 配…

SpringBoot使用SOFA-Lookout监控

本文介绍SpringBoot使用蚂蚁金服SOFA-Lookout配合Prometheus进行监控。 1.SOFA-Lookout介绍 上一篇已经介绍使用Prometheus进行暴露SpringBoot的一些指标进行监控,传送门,这一篇介绍如何使用SOFA-Lookout配合Prometheus。 SOFA-Lookout是蚂蚁金服开源的…

python迷宫小游戏大全_Python迷宫小游戏源代码、源程序

Python迷宫小游戏源程序包括两个文件maze.py和mazeGenerator.py,mazeGenerator.py实现迷宫地图的生成,程序运行截图:mazeGenerator.pyimport numpy as npimport randomimport copyclass UnionSet(object): """ 并查集实…

NoSQL最新现状和趋势:云NoSQL数据库将成重要增长引擎

NoSQL最早起源于1998年,但从2009年开始,NoSQL真正开始逐渐兴起和发展。回望历史应该说NoSQL数据库的兴起,完全是十年来伴随互联网技术,大数据数据的兴起和发展,NoSQL在面临大数据场景下相对于关系型数据库运用&#xf…

详谈ARM架构与ARM内核发展史

戳蓝字“CSDN云计算”关注我们哦!作者 | 架构师技术联盟责编 | 阿秃1、ARM架构与ARM内核1.1 ARM架构与内核简述目前为止,ARM总共发布8种架构:ARMv1、ARMv2、ARMv3、ARMv4、ARMv5、ARMv6、ARMv7 、ARMv8,这是ARM架构指令集的多个v版…

DMN结合bpmn简化流程_07

项目地址:https://gitee.com/lwj/flowable.git 分支flowable-base 视频地址:https://www.bilibili.com/video/av79774697/ DMN集成到BPMN中使用 简化流程,让我们的BPMN显得更加优雅 * DMN集成bpmn使用 新建决策树模板 注意一定要部署&…

阿里云RPA(机器人流程自动化)干货系列之一:认识RPA(上)

本文是阿里云RPA(机器人流程自动化)干货系列的开山之作,全面、详细的剖析了RPA的基本概念、给企业带来的价值点以及RPA的优劣势分析。 一、什么是RPA? 人类社会进入21世纪的第一个十年之后,全球企业大都面临着两个严峻…

linux pip3使用清华源_Linux实战016:Ubuntu搭建python开发环境

我们在安装Ubuntu系统的时候会自带安装python2.7和python3.6版本的Python解释器,直接执行"ptyhon"默认运行的是python2.7,只有执行"python3"时才会运行python3.6版本。Python解释器默认安装在/usr/bin目录下,但是Ubuntu并…

编写一个C程序,实现以下功能:定义一个学生结构体Student(含学号、姓名、年龄、身高)和一个函数sort(struct Student *p),该函数使用选择排序法按年龄由小到大排序。在主函数中

编写一个C程序,实现以下功能: 定义一个学生结构体Student(含学号、姓名、年龄、身高)和一个函数sort(struct Student *p),该函数使用选择排序法按年龄由小到大排序。在主函数中输入10个学生的学号、姓名、年龄和身高,调用sort函数…

在抖音上刷到AI程序员的工资条后,我笑了,别吹了!

2020年,程序员会怎么样?A与B ,薪酬与前景程序员与远方2017年~2018年,是人工智能大火的时候。你会发现,跟朋友聊天不谈人工智能,聊天的bigger都上不去。作为一个前景明朗的朝阳行业,高薪吸引&…

C++面向对象思想 两条直线交点计算

我相信哪怕一点光,也能驱散学习中的迷雾,我在这分享一点自己的挫见 思路: 这题最大的难点就是abc三个常数要怎么去构造,这里需要数学公式去推导,虽然是初中水平,也能体现编程和数学密不可分了。因为我之后…

K8s 实践 | 如何解决多租户集群的安全隔离问题?

戳蓝字“CSDN云计算”关注我们哦!作者 | 匡大虎责编 | 阿秃导读:如何解决多租户集群的安全隔离问题是企业上云的一个关键问题,本文主要介绍 Kubernetes 多租户集群的基本概念和常见应用形态,以及在企业内部共享集群的业务场景下&a…

scara机器人dh参数表_两分钟带你了解机器人标定的因素

为什么机器人需要标定?影响机器人本体精度因素分为两大类:运动学因素——加工误差、机械公差/装配误差、减速器精度、减速器空程等;动力学因素——质量、惯性张量、摩擦力、关节柔性、连杆柔性。机器人本体的实际精度和理论设计模型可能会存在…